New brand bears good tidings for electronic music lovers
By Chen Nan | China Daily | Updated: 2018-10-20 07:33
NetEase, Inc., one of China's leading internet services which boasts a following of more than 400 million online users, launched a new electronic music brand called Fever, or Fang Ci in Chinese, in Shanghai on Oct 12.
According to Jessie Wang, CEO of Fever, the brand will offer electronic music fans access to live shows, music tours, music production and VR-based online DJ games.
"Electronic music is one of the fastest-growing music genres in China, but compared to the West, the Chinese electronic music scene has only just started," says Wang in Shanghai.
